Cash-money
cash, as distinguished from a check or money order.

- Cash on the barrelhead
Immediate payment, as in They won’t extend credit; it’s cash on the barrelhead or no sale. - Cash ratio
noun the ratio of cash on hand to total deposits that by law or custom commercial banks must maintain Also called liquidity ratio
